Staying over night

  • Camping and tent camping in the Sompio Strict Nature Reserve is only allowed on the shores of Lake Sompiojärvi, and you may stay there for a maximum of three days at one time. There is a lean-to shelter, a Lapp 'kota' hut and campfire sites on the shore of Lake Sompiojärvi, which can be used for overnight stays.
  • The Palovartijantupa -hut at Pyhä-Nattanen serves as a weather shelter; it does not have a stove, and there is no fireplace at the summit. Overnight stays are not allowed in the cabin.
  • The Nalijoki lean-to shelter is intended for day use only, and overnight stays are not permitted.
  • When camping, be considerate towards other hikers and those staying overnight. They may be tired after their day’s hike and wish to enjoy the peace and quiet of nature.
